Oklahoma's 8th Congressional district is an obsolete district from Oklahoma. It was added in 1915, and was eliminated in 1953.
List of representatives
Name Party Years District residence Notes District created March 4, 1915 Dick Thompson Morgan Republican March 4, 1915 – July 4, 1920 Woodward, Oklahoma Redistricted from the 2nd district, Died Charles Swindall Republican November 2, 1920 – March 4, 1921 Woodward, Oklahoma Manuel Herrick Republican March 4, 1921 – March 4, 1923 Perry, Oklahoma Milton C. Garber Republican March 4, 1923 – March 4, 1933 Enid, Oklahoma E. W. Marland Democratic March 4, 1933 – January 3, 1935 Ponca City, Oklahoma Phil Ferguson Democratic January 3, 1935 – January 3, 1941 Woodward, Oklahoma Ross Rizley Republican January 3, 1941 – January 3, 1949 Guymon, Oklahoma George H. Wilson Democratic January 3, 1949 – January 3, 1951 Enid, Oklahoma Page Belcher Republican January 3, 1951 – January 3, 1953 Enid, Oklahoma Redistricted to the 1st district District eliminated January 3, 1953 References
